Abstract

The general linear metamodel has been found to be an effective tool in post-simulation analysis. This paper addresses the multiple response problem in simulation and proposes a multivariate general linear metamodel as an aid in understanding and interpreting simulation results. Such a metamodel was developed using multiple response data generated from an M/M/1 queueing system simulation. The results supported the author's contention as to the value and validity of this type of multivariate technique in simulation.
